Cricketer. .. .An IR (at the end of basic training) is merely a test to let you fly an aircraft as a single pilot in Instrument conditions , as its name suggests. It is not a personality test or anything the like and neither should it be, it is a handling test.. .. .An airline wants someone with an IR to show that they are able to fly but it is then the airline who has to decide if you will fit in with the company culture. Each airline is different in its ways from the British Airways to the Ryanairs.. .. .I am sure in what ever field you have come from that you have worked with people who are academicaly qualified and able to do the job but are an absolute nightmare to work with. There are also people who have the academics who still cant do the job. The airline industry is the same but generaly as flight crew you work much closer to your workmates than in an office. It is also much more safty critical that you are able to interact as a team.. .. .CRM is taught on the MCC course but if your a prat to start with the MCC will teach you nothing.
